The U.S. Congress is accelerating encryption legislation and aims to complete it before August
On April 28th, news came that US congressmen returned to Congress after the Easter recess and prioritized cryptocurrency legislation, aiming to complete the stablecoin and market structure bill before the August deadline set by President Trump. The House Financial Services Committee and Agriculture Committee will hold a joint hearing on May 6th to discuss the blueprint for digital asset legislation. The Senate is also integrating the contents of the 2022 Lummis-Gillibrand Act and the FIT21 Act.
